Step 1: Identify the area under the speed versus time graph from time \( t = 0 \) to \( t = 5 \) seconds.
Step 2: The graph indicates a linear increase in speed from \( 0 \) to \( 10 \, \text{ms}^{-1} \) over \( 5 \) seconds, representing uniform acceleration.
Step 3: Calculate the area under the graph (which equals the distance traveled). The area of a triangle is given by \( \frac{1}{2} \times \text{base} \times \text{height} \). Here, \( \text{base} = 5 \) seconds and \( \text{height} = 10 \, \text{ms}^{-1} \).
Step 4: Calculate the area (distance):
\[ \text{Distance} = \frac{1}{2} \times 5 \times 10 = 25 \, \text{m} \]
Therefore, B.
